Where Did POG Come From?

The history of POG is more complicated than its current slang meaning.

The original term POG was not created as gaming slang.

POG was the name associated with a type of collectible milk-cap game that became popular in the late 20th century. Players used circular cardboard or plastic caps in games involving stacking and knocking them down.

The term later became connected to internet culture through PogChamp, a popular Twitch emote.

The emote showed an exaggerated surprised or excited facial reaction. It became a recognizable symbol for moments that were:

  • Unexpected
  • Exciting
  • Impressive
  • Shocking
  • Entertaining

Over time, people began using POG independently of the original image.

That is how POG developed from a specific cultural reference into a general internet reaction.

What Is PogChamp?

PogChamp is an internet expression and emote strongly connected with the modern use of POG.

The term became particularly popular through Twitch and livestreaming culture.

When viewers saw something incredible happen on a stream, they could use the PogChamp emote to communicate an excited reaction.

Eventually, POG became a shortened and more flexible expression.

For example:

  • PogChamp = a specific emote/reaction
  • POG = excitement or approval
  • Poggers = an exaggerated or playful version of POG

The three terms are related, but they are not always interchangeable.

Why Is POG Still Popular?

Internet slang often survives when it becomes part of a recognizable online culture.

POG became popular because it was short, expressive, and easy to use during fast-moving livestreams and gaming sessions.

It also worked well visually. The associated reaction image and emote gave people a quick way to communicate an emotion without typing a full sentence.

Over time, the word moved beyond its original context.

People began using POG:

  • As a standalone reaction
  • As a comment
  • As a meme
  • As an adjective
  • As part of “POG moment”
  • As “Poggers”
  • As a humorous reaction to everyday events

This flexibility helped it become a recognizable piece of internet vocabulary.

Is POG an Acronym?

People sometimes assume that POG must stand for a phrase because it is written in capital letters.

In modern internet slang, however, POG is generally used as a standalone slang expression rather than a conventional acronym meaning a particular sentence.

Its modern internet meaning developed through gaming and Twitch culture rather than from a standard phrase formed from the letters P-O-G.

This distinction is important because many internet terms look like acronyms even when their history is different.
